NEW BODIPY DYES FOR PHOTODYNAMIC TERAGNOSIS BASED ON ACCUMULATION IN MITOCHONDRIA
WO21255319
Structurally simple organic compounds with antitumour activity by acting on mitochondria through various action mechanisms hold substantial promise for development as cancer treatment agents. The present invention relates to new compounds with F-BODIPY structure capable of specific accumulation in mitochondria, of exhibiting photocytotoxicity without the need to involve heavy atoms or other functional residues capable of interacting in biological processes, and with the potential for developing new teragnostic agents for clinical use. Furthermore, it relates to their obtainment process and their application as fluorescent markers of mitochondria, and as photocytotoxic agents for photodynamic therapy (PDT) and phototheragnostics based on mitochondrial accumulation.

ADVANTAGES: New compounds increase the efficiency of theragostic agents based on fluorescence and photocytotoxicity, through its specific accumulation in mitochondria, as well as the marking specific of said organelles, based on a new structural design of easy synthetic access based on BODIPY. APPLICATIONS: - Efficient labeling of mitochondria aimed at improving the study of these organelles using techniques based on fluorescence microscopy, and its implication in the development of certain pathologies (e.g., cancer). - Diagnosis of mitochondrial diseases through fluorescent bioimaging of mitochondria - Precision medicine (diagnosis and therapy) directed at certain diseases, through fluorescent bioimaging and photodynamic therapy, supported by the same agent endowed with high efficiency and low inherent toxicity, due to its effective specific accumulation in mitochondria - Design of new theragnostic agents based on the strategy of enhancing their activity dual by specific accumulation in mitochondria.
